#c36a39 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c36a39 is composed of 76.5% red, 41.6%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.6% magenta, 70.8%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 21.3 degrees, a saturation of 54.8% and a lightness of 49.4%. #c36a39 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d472 with #870000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#c36a39 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c36a39 has RGB values of R:195, G:106,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.71,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12806713.

Hex triplet c36a39 #c36a39
RGB Decimal 195, 106, 57 rgb(195,106,57)
RGB Percent 76.5, 41.6, 22.4 rgb(76.5%,41.6%,22.4%)
CMYK 0, 46, 71, 24
HSL 21.3°, 54.8, 49.4 hsl(21.3,54.8%,49.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 21.3°, 70.8, 76.5
Web Safe cc6633 #cc6633
CIE-LAB 54.247, 31.477, 42.307
XYZ 28.399, 22.208, 6.662
xyY 0.496, 0.388, 22.208
CIE-LCH 54.247, 52.733, 53.35
CIE-LUV 54.247, 70.464, 39.188
Hunter-Lab 47.125, 25.1, 24.606
Binary 11000011, 01101010, 00111001

Shades and Tints of #c36a39

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0704 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#c36a39 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#7f7f7f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#8d7b71 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#95884a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a7823e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#c86c73 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a67d43 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b1793c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#c66b5d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
